Exploring the Spectrum of Indian Flavors: Must-Try Dishes
No exploration of Indian food is complete without delving into some of the most iconic and beloved dishes.
Butter Chicken
This creamy and flavorful dish is a staple of Indian cuisine and a favorite among both newcomers and seasoned veterans. Tender pieces of tandoori chicken are simmered in a rich tomato-based sauce, infused with butter, cream, and a blend of aromatic spices. The result is a dish that is both comforting and indulgent. You can find excellent versions of Butter Chicken at both Spice Route Restaurant and Taj Mahal Indian Cuisine.
Chicken Tikka Masala
Another classic Indian dish, Chicken Tikka Masala features marinated and grilled chicken in a creamy and flavorful tomato-based sauce. While similar to Butter Chicken, Chicken Tikka Masala typically has a slightly spicier and more complex flavor profile. This dish is also widely available at most Indian restaurants in Panama City.
Biryani
This fragrant rice dish is a celebration of flavor and aroma. Biryani typically consists of basmati rice cooked with meat (chicken, lamb, or goat), vegetables, and a blend of aromatic spices. The rice is often layered with the meat and vegetables, creating a visually stunning and incredibly delicious dish. Taj Mahal Indian Cuisine is particularly known for its excellent Biryani.
Vegetarian Delights
Indian cuisine offers a plethora of vegetarian options, showcasing the versatility and creativity of Indian cooking. Saag Paneer, a creamy spinach dish with cubes of Indian cheese, is a popular and flavorful choice. Chana Masala, a chickpea curry cooked with tomatoes, onions, and spices, is another excellent vegetarian option. Dal Makhani, a slow-cooked lentil dish simmered with butter and cream, is a rich and comforting vegetarian staple.
Breads: The Perfect Accompaniment
No Indian meal is complete without a selection of freshly baked breads. Naan, a soft and pillowy flatbread cooked in a tandoor oven, is a classic choice. Garlic Naan, infused with garlic and herbs, is a particularly popular variation. Roti, a whole-wheat flatbread, is a healthier and more rustic option.
Sweet Endings: Indulge in Dessert
After savoring the savory delights of Indian cuisine, be sure to leave room for dessert. Gulab Jamun, deep-fried milk balls soaked in a sweet rose-flavored syrup, is a classic Indian sweet. Kheer, a creamy rice pudding flavored with cardamom and nuts, is another popular and comforting dessert option.
Tips for Enjoying Indian Food to the Fullest
To ensure a truly enjoyable Indian dining experience, consider these helpful tips:
Spice Level Awareness: Indian food is known for its use of spices, and some dishes can be quite spicy. Be sure to ask your server about the spice level of each dish and specify your preferred level of heat. Most restaurants are happy to adjust the spice level to your liking.
Dietary Considerations: Indian restaurants typically offer a wide range of vegetarian, vegan, and gluten-free options. Be sure to inform your server of any dietary restrictions or allergies.
Sharing is Encouraged: Indian food is best enjoyed when shared with friends or family. Order a variety of dishes and sample each other’s selections to experience the full range of flavors.
Seek Recommendations: Don’t hesitate to ask your server for recommendations. They can provide valuable insights into the menu and suggest dishes that you might enjoy.
